Nutella - No So Expensive After All


My newest food obsession is now Nutella.  If you are not familiar with it, it is a hazelnut and cocoa spread.  Instead of using peanut butter on a sandwich, you can use Nutella.

For many years, I wanted to try Nutella but I was never able to because of the price.  Finally, Nutella's price has gone down and it is reasonable to buy.  Now that I've tasted it, I can't ever imagine how I lived without it.  The taste is very similar to the chocolate and hazelnut candy called Ferraro Rocher. 

The best thing about Nutella is you can use it for sandwiches.  I make a Nutella and jelly sandwich many days for work now.  This is perfect if you are bored with peanut butter and jelly.  When I am very broke, I find myself eating only peanut butter and jelly sandwiches for work each day.  This is not by choice; this is only because it is all I can afford.

If you are in the same position stuck and bored with peanut butter and jelly sandwiches, I recommend giving Nutella a try.  It might really help your boring sandwich become more interesting.  For now, the price of Nutella is just under $3 at Walmart and $3 at Target.  Yes, that is slightly more expensive than peanut butter, but it is worth it if you might actually enjoy lunch each day.  Also, sometimes you even come across $1 off coupons for Nutella, so it makes the price even better.  So give Nutella a try!

Just Buy What You Need

For those of you that are big fans of scoping out sales and using coupons, you can save lots of money.  This weekend I bought $80 worth of groceries for $45. This is quite excellent for me, even though some "extreme couponers" would surely frown upon it.  I am sure they would be able to buy $800 worth of groceries for $45.  However, I try not to compare myself to others.  I feel like I achieved a great deal.

What you have to consider when making "extreme couponing" purchases is if you will actually use what you are buying.  Certainly it is a great deal to buy 10 jars of pasta sauce at once if it is on sale and you have coupons, but make sure to check the expiration date and consider how much pasta you actually eat.  If you do not even really like pasta and you might only use 4 jars, you have actually wasted money.  It does not matter if you bought 10 for 50 cents a piece.  If 6 go to waste, you just lost $3.

This sounds like a relatively simple concept until a person becomes obsessed with finding the best bargains.  Suddenly, it is not about what is practical.  It is about getting whatever is the cheapest.  Aside from losing money by looking for bargains, you also need to be realistic about what you like to eat. 

For example, I like to eat junk food.  I am constantly trying to eat healthier.  So say one day there is a great sale on apples.  That is perfect.  Apples are a healthy, wonderful snack.  I can buy a few apples and eat them during the week.  However, if even just one bag of candy goes into the cart, good bye apples.  Chances are, the apples will get tossed to the side and I will eat candy all week.  Now, the apples, even though they were on sale, will go to waste.

When shopping, be realistic about what you will really eat.  If you are trying to be healthy, buy healthy foods that are on sale, but DO NOT buy junk food.  Junk food will lure you away from the healthy food every time.  Right now, I have a bag of what was once delicious broccoli in my fridge.  Now, it looks terrible and must be thrown out.  Lesson learned - buy frozen broccoli even if it is more expensive.  Frozen broccoli lasts much longer.  You lose money when you are constantly throwing stuff out.
